"śaśi" meaning in Old Javanese

See śaśi in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

Etymology: From Sanskrit शशि (śaśi, “containing a hare, moon”). Here, "containing" refers to "resembling", since the moon's apparent color is similar to that of a hare.   1. moon Synonyms: śaśī, sasih
